10 Percent Job Stress Triggered Stroke Cases

Be careful with the stress of work that occurs continuously. A recent study in the Journal of Occupational and Environmental Medicine showed that psychological stress caused by work can increase the risk of stroke 1.4 times in men of middle and upper economic circles.

If counted, about 10 percent of stroke cases in this study have been associated with mental stress on the job.
